Can't tell you if this'll ever be changed, but right now stuff you're trying to print may not have any subgrids or those will get deleted from the projection.
So you'll either have to print the main body and manually attach all of the extra stuff or somehow manage to align about a dozen separate projections perfectly to get each part printed.
Or - you know - get it spawned as intended.
